Not good at lighting the road
I put both of these in to replace a burnt-out bulb I had on one side. From what I could tell, they didn't light up the road very well on a street with no lights. I thought maybe it was my imagination, so I put in the one good bulb I had, and it was noticeably better. It was obvious that these bulbs didn't light as well as the 15-year-old OEM one did. Bought an OEM Osram bulb which is great.

Haven’t seen it at night
So, I haven’t actually tested the bulbs; however, just for anyone wondering these are 8000k temp lights which unfortunately for me is illegal in California. California law requires white light (4000k-6000k) above 6000k turns the light blue and is less bright than legal standard. I didn’t see anywhere on the listing of the Kelvin temp I also was able to buy them and ship them to myself in CA, which should have said “not available for delivery location,” or whatever they say. I’m going to wait until tonight to see how well the bulbs actually work but still illegal in my state and I don’t need CHP finding a reason to pull me over.******update; Had myself and my two roommates look at the beam at night, a **** ton brighter and definitely 8000k, closer to 6000k it’s still yellow/white but so much brighter than the bulbs (according to service records, original 20+ years old) I had in the car, not sure about longevity but as far as working, brightness and ease of install I recommend.

Easy to replace, but maybe temperature sensitive.
These worked pretty well, but in cold temperatures (at least for me, under freezing) the bulbs would intermittently fail.They were also a bit more blue than I liked. But 8000k is 8000k, they're gonna be blue.All in all, it's not bad, and it works. (Unless it's a bit on the cold side, then... well, maybe you'll have better luck than I did.)
